Ploom and GCDS Walk Together During Milan Fashion Week
Ploom collaborates with GCDS at Milan Fashion Week, highlighting the synergy between visionary aesthetics and contemporary lifestyle.
At Milan Fashion Week, Ploom, a brand of tobacco heating devices from Japan Tobacco International (JTI), has joined forces with Italian fashion label GCDS to showcase a unique blend of visionary design and modern lifestyle. The collaboration celebrates their strong partnership that began on the runway, where Ploom integrated into GCDS's fashion show through exclusive accessories specifically designed for the event. One standout piece is the 'ploom case,' creatively inspired by GCDS's iconic Comma Bag, illustrating the functionality and stylish details that enhance the collection's looks while bridging fashion and technology.
The collaboration emphasizes Ploom's identity as a compact, sophisticated, and technologically advanced accessory, which merges performance with aesthetic appeal.
